Church History

Pastor Emeritus Wilbur Allen, Jr. and Mother Charlotte Allen where saved in 1965 at Pentecostal Temple Church of God in Christ under the pastorate of the late Elder Lee Nucklos. The late Bishop R.S. Fields ordained him an Elder in July, 1973. He began his ministry by conducting street services. On August 20th, 1988, the late Bishop William James appointed Pastor Allen to the office of Jurisdictional Devotional Chairman of the Ohio North Jurisdiction #1. For fifteen years, Pastor Allen was assistant devotional leader to the late Elder J.H. Anderson.

Mother Allen is truly a handmaiden of the Lord. She is a meticulous woman that is a role model of role models. Mother Allen often says that “Every single day the Lord does something special for me.” Mother is a 1963 graduate of Akron school of Practical Nursing of the University of Akron

Upon the urging of the Lord, Elder Wilbur H. Allen, Jr. obeyed God’s call to start a ministry. After locating a storefront building complex on the corner of Lawrence Road and Spring Avenue N.E. in Canton, Ohio, Elder Allen secured the building. Upon completion of the rehab project then called Grace Parish C.O.G.I.C, held it’s first services on June 24, 1979. Pastor Allen preached and prayed, and the power of God moved and the house was shaken! The Lord saved and added souls to the church continuously. Truly God established the church. The church hosted the Late Dr. Martin Luther King, Sr. as a gust speaker for the church benefit dinner. Ministries included a free clothing center which was a blessing to church members as ell as the community. In 1985 under the pastors leadership, the church purchased and remodeled Turner’s Chapel United Methodist Church and renamed it All Saints Temple C.O.G.I.C. After serving twenty six years as pastor of All Saints Temple, Elder Wilbur Allen, Jr. Elected to retire from parish ministry. The congregation unanimously accepted Elder Wilbur H. Allen III as pastor.  On August 14, 2005, Bishop Walter Earl Jordon, Jurisdictional Bishop of the First Ecclesiastical Jurisdiction of Ohio North, formally installed him.
